Twins Starter David Festa Is done for the season after a setback while working a shoulder injury, relay Bobby Nightengale of the Minnesota Star Tribune. Festa is on its way to a consultation with the well -known orthopedist Dr. Keith Meister.

The 25-year-old Festa has been out since mid-July. Minnesota sent him to Triple-A St. Paul for a rehabilitation start on 28 August. Festa threw five after more 2/3 scoreless innings. It seems that he came out of the appearance with renewed shoulder pain. That will close him the year. The twins will hope that there is nothing structurally wrong that will influence its availability for 2026.

Festa is in his second big league season. He missed bats at an above -average pace, but has given up a few too many home runs, which contributes to a 5.12 ERA during his first 25 performances. This year Festa gave 5.40 points earned per nine over 53 1/3 frames. The 6’6 ″ Righty was one of the better pitching overviews of Minnesota for his debut. He is one of the handful of pitchers from the mid -20s of whom the twins hope that the long -term rotary pieces will be.

Zebby MatthewsSimeon Woods Richardson and deadline -acquisition Taj Bradley are in the current start of five. Mick Abelacquired from Philadelphia in the Jhoan Duran Deal, hit hard in his first two performances such as twins and was returned to Triple-A yesterday. Festa is on the 15-day injured list, so the twins can transfer him to the 60-day IL if they have to open a 40-man roster place before the end of the season. This season he crossed the service line of one year and is under club control by at least 2030.
